Abstract

A receptacle for disposal of used, sharp, medical instruments or other biohazards, comprising an upright container, which is closed except for a slot in a top wall, a chute which is mounted integrally to the top wall so as to extend downwardly, a shroud, which is mounted integrally to the top wall so as to extend upwardly, and a scoop, which is mounted pivotally to the top wall at a back margin of the slot. The scoop and shroud are configured so as to form a tray, which is adapted to hold one or more such instruments until the instruments held by the tray are discharged through the slot, via the chute, into the container. The scoop, shroud, and chute are configured so as to impede an object, such as a person's finger, which may have been inserted through the slot from reaching any such instruments in the containers. The scoop and chute are configured so as to impede any liquid contents of the container from splattering outside the receptacle.
